git 版本控制

2022-07-21 20:51:21 字數 1140 閱讀 7177

配置使用者名稱以及郵箱,git安裝完成後,在桌面右鍵 選擇 git bash here

$ git config --global user.name "

你的名字或暱稱

"$ git config --global user.email "

你的郵箱

"

$ git version

git version

2.9.3.windows.2

$ ssh-keygen -t rsa -c 「你的郵箱」

$ ssh [email protected]

$ git clone '

在專案首頁複製ssh或者https的位址

'

$ git init

$ git add .  #會遞迴新增當前工作目錄中所有的檔案

$ git commit -m "

輸入提示資訊

"

$ git remote add [xx]

$ git push -u [xx] master

$ git log

$ git reflog

$ git branch  # 列出分支 建立分支 刪除分支

$ git branch -v # 檢視每乙個分支的最後一次提交

$ git branch [分支名] # 建立乙個新的分支

$ git branch -d [分支名] # 刪除該分支

$ git checkout [分支名]  # 切換到乙個分支.

$ git checkout -b [分支名] # 建立並切換到新的分支

$ git pull

$ git reset --hard [sha1]

$ git config --gobal core.autocrlf false  

$ git init

$ git add .

$ git commit -m "注釋"

git版本控制

1.git 是乙個開源的分布式版本控制系統,可以有效 高速的處理從很小到非常大的專案版本 管理。2.git配置管理 一般,有乙個 集中庫,包含4個分支 qa才能merge production 發布生產,出現生產問題,轉hotfix 研發經理 hotfix 解決緊急生產問題,測試後轉producti...

版本控制 Git

git 是目前世界上最先進的開源的分布式版本控制系統 沒有之一 用於敏捷高效地處理任何或小或大的專案。git 是 linus torvalds 為了幫助管理 linux核心開發而開發的乙個開放原始碼的版本控制軟體。git 與常用的版本控制工具 cvs,subversion 等不同,它採用了分布式版本...

GIT版本控制

不同情況下,實現版本回退 1.對於修改內容後,未add,未commit 可以利用git checkout 檔名 2.對於修改內容後,add,未commit get reset head 檔名 git checkout 檔名 3.對於修改內容後,add,commit 可以回到任何乙個版本 root g...